Star Wars: Dark Forces Remaster Launches February 28th, 2024

The remaster is based on the 1995 first-person shooter and offers improved visuals and cutscenes, gamepad support, and more.

Star Wars Dark Forces Remaster

Nightdive Studios’ Star Wars: Dark Forces Remaster will launch on February 28th, 2024, per GameSpot. It’s based on LucasArts’ Star Wars-based first-person shooter from 1995, also released on February 28th for MS-DOS.

The story focuses on Kyle Katarn, who joins the Rebel Alliance and infiltrates the Galactic Empire to learn about the Dark Trooper Project. Though its sequel, Dark Forces 2: Jedi Knight, is probably better known, the original offers some solid first-person shooting in the Star Wars setting. The remaster is done through Nightdive’s KEX engine, supporting resolutions up to 4K and 120 frames per second.

Players can also look forward to improved lighting and rendering, enhanced cutscenes, gamepad support, high-resolution textures, a weapon wheel for managing your arsenal and Trophies/Achievements. The remaster will be available for Xbox One, Xbox Series X/S, PS4, PS5 and PC via Steam.

Nightdive is also working on System Shock 2: Enhanced Edition (which received a new trailer recently) and Turok 3: Shadow of Oblivion Remastered (releasing on November 14th). Stay tuned for more details on both in the coming months.
